Rodney Messer, 68, Jamestown, ND passed away Friday, July 21, 2017 at Vibra Hospital, Fargo, ND.
Rodney Messer was born March 16, 1949 in Griggs County, the son of Monroe and Evelyn (Anderson) Messer. He went to Hannaford until he graduated. Rodney entered the U.S. Army on March 3, 1970. On March 6, 1971 he married Sandra (Kreutsberg) Messer. They lived in Jamestown. They had two children Jodi and Trent Messer, both of Jamestown; one grandchild Kassandra, daughter of Jodi.
Rodney worked for Wedgecor for 45 years. His hobbies included spending time with family and friends. Rodney enjoyed fishing, camping, riding motorcycle and playing games with family.
